About The Job
IT Operations and Infrastructure
- Manage and continuously improve Grindr's Mac-first, Google Workspace environment across Bay Area, Chicago, Los Angeles, and New York offices
- Oversee IT helpdesk support, hardware lifecycle, onboarding/offboarding workflows, and day-to-day ticket resolution alongside your team
- Maintain and optimize our identity and access management platform (OneLogin), including user provisioning, access reviews, and SSO integrations
- Partner with IT leadership on the evaluation of in-house vs. outsourced/hybrid helpdesk models as the company scales
- Own IT General Controls (ITGCs) including access management, change management, and IT operations controls in support of Grindr's SOX program
- Work directly with external auditors during annual SOX cycles - this means you're the operator and the point of contact, not a supporting cast member
- Maintain documentation, evidence collection, and remediation tracking for IT controls in scope
- Lead and oversee workflow automation projects using Workato, including building and maintaining integration recipes that reduce manual effort across IT and cross-functional teams
- Evaluate and implement AI tools that improve IT operations efficiency - this includes vetting new tools, managing rollouts, and establishing governance guardrails
- Stay ahead of the tooling curve; Grindr moves fast and expects IT to move with it
- Directly manage 2 full-time IT engineers (New York, Los Angeles) and 3 contractors (Bay Area, Chicago)
- Own contractor performance, timecard oversight, and vendor relationships - including the ability to make hard calls when performance isn't meeting expectations
- Develop your team through coaching, feedback, and hands-on mentorship
- 5+ years in IT, with at least 2 years in a management or senior lead capacity
- Proven SOX ITGC ownership - you've worked directly with external auditors and can speak fluently to access management, change management, and IT operations controls
- Deep hands-on experience in a Mac-first, Google Workspace environment
- Identity and access management experience - OneLogin or Okta administration, not just usage
- Demonstrated experience managing a mix of FTE and contractor staff in a distributed, multi-office environment
- Automation experience with iPaaS tools (Workato, Zapier, or equivalent) - you've built or managed workflows, not just been adjacent to them
- Experience at an AI-native or AI-forward tech company, with hands-on involvement in evaluating or rolling out AI productivity and IT tools
- Direct Workato experience, including recipe development and integration management
- Experience advising on or transitioning between in-house helpdesk and managed/outsourced models
- Familiarity with the compliance and operational demands of a public or recently-IPO'd tech company
